I've got an '81 D150 with the "lean burn" computer. The previous owner cut the lead and removed the Coolant Temperature Sensor (CTS) for the computer, apparently thinking it was for the idiot light, and replaced it with a sensor for an aftermarket temp gage. Gee, ... I wonder why it doesn't run so good? :shock:

I'm amazed it runs as well as it does, it is drivable, just doesn't run quite right, but if a $10 sensor will help it, I'll do that until I rip the lean burn out next spring.

The local dealer's computer listings won't go back older then '84, and the likely canidate from an '84 is listed as NLA and the chian stores tell me "it is not required on this vehicle"

Does anyone have an '81 D150 lean burn without a feed back carb that can get the number off of their CTS or a picture / description of what it looks like?

It is the larger one located at the front of the cyl head, the smaller one on the side is for the gage.

Looks like the one you need is a Standard-BlueStreak #TX7.
